Quanto mais experi¨ºncia adquirimos usando tecnologias de registro distribu¨ªdo (DLT), mais encontramos limita??es em torno do estado atual dos . Publicar contratos automatizados, irrefut¨¢veis e irrevers¨ªveis parece ¨®timo na teoria. Os problemas surgem quando voc¨º leva em conta como usar t¨¦cnicas modernas de entrega de software para desenvolv¨º-los, assim como as diferen?as entre as implementa??es. Dados imut¨¢veis s?o uma coisa, mas a l¨®gica de neg¨®cios imut¨¢vel ¨¦ algo completamente diferente. ? muito importante pensar se devemos incluir l¨®gica de neg¨®cios em um contrato inteligente. Tamb¨¦m encontramos caracter¨ªsticas operacionais muito diferentes entre implementa??es diferentes. Por exemplo, mesmo que contratos possam evoluir, plataformas diferentes suportam essa evolu??o em maior ou menor grau. Nosso conselho ¨¦ refletir muito antes de comprometer a l¨®gica de neg¨®cios em um contrato inteligente e pesar os m¨¦ritos de diferentes plataformas antes de fazer isso.

